The stock light duty 3-sp was used behind many transplants of the day, including Olds Rocket V8's, Buick nailheads, and Caddy V8s. As long as you're not doing burnouts a lot, it will give a reasonably good life. If you want to avoid cutting on the crossmember, a HD 3-sp would be just the ticket. Totally bolt-in, just some driveshaft mods. You should have a 3.73 rear axle, that really isn't too bad as long as you run tall tires (28" - 29")

I'm of the Option 1 persuasion, you have plenty of places to spend time and money on it without touching the drivetrain.

I ran Willard, my 49 for a number of years with a 56 Nailhead Buick thru the stock trans, however fairly early on I found a heavy duty 3 speed and installed it. I had to replace syncros and gears a couple of times in the LD trans. The problems went away with the HD trans install. I would definitely recommend the HD 3 speed behind the sbf.
